Output e8114a185495f3d2bc740721cd319bebafa5d5d82b9f05daac6260acc0a23887:0

value
758831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e9dcdc5666b563bb9f36d6ce702e7983501b29a OP_EQUAL
address
3DEW77aJv2Hcu2hLsA64bbD8XWkzknPvyy
transaction
e8114a185495f3d2bc740721cd319bebafa5d5d82b9f05daac6260acc0a23887
spent
true